摘要
根据声像定位应用及FPGA内部结构的特点,对分布式算法的实现做了若干优化,设计了一个具有通用性的高性能声像定位协处理器,并用FPGA最终实现了对声像的虚拟定位.经Xilinx公司FPGAxc5vlx110t验证,即使采用多达512点的HRTF,其处理能力依然可达264.061 Mbit/s,比未经优化的实现节省资源72%.虚拟定位的声像经真人试听测试均包含正确的位置信息,且对原声的失真较小.
A general and high-performance coprocessor, which implements localization of sound image based on FPGA, is designed by considering the characters of localization of sound image and architecture of FPGA, in order to optimize the implementation of distributed arithmetic. Verified by FPGA xc5vlx110t of Xilinx, coprocessor can,even dealing with up to 512 points HRTF, produce 264. 061 Mbit/s data rate with 72% inside resource cost reduced comparing to the implementation before optimizing. Virtual localized sound images have also been approved to contain correct localization information and very few distortion of the source by testing on real people.
出处
《南开大学学报(自然科学版)》
CAS
CSCD
北大核心
2010年第4期19-24,共6页
Acta Scientiarum Naturalium Universitatis Nankaiensis
基金
天津市科技计划项目(09ZCGYGX101100)